The Show’s Relevance

According to the opinion piece, “American Revolution” is more than just historical retelling. It is highlighted as must-see TV, suggesting that the program carries importance for those interested in understanding—or revisiting—an essential chapter in American heritage.

National Identity in the Spotlight

Central to the article is the eight-word line, “Our great title is Americans.” This quote underscores the show’s thematic focus on what binds people together under a shared identity. By spotlighting this phrase, the opinion underscores the unifying message that the nation’s story belongs to all citizens.
